About Mont Tremblant
Skiiers have flocked to Mont Tremblant since its first chairlift and lodge opened in 1939. Now, though, it's just as popular with snowboarders, who love its 18 acres of ramps, rails and jumps, and its Olympic-caliber superpipe. Don't fret, though, because despite its name, this mountain doesn't actually tremble... unless you've tossed back a few too many in one of the village's bars!

If you're a more budget-conscious traveler, then you may want to consider traveling to Mont Tremblant between September and November, when hotel prices are generally the lowest. Peak hotel prices generally start between December and February.
